Port Hueneme

Port Hueneme, California, a small beach city in Ventura County, is renowned for its Naval Base Ventura County and the Hueneme Pier. With a rich history in agriculture and trade, it's a key player in the import and export industry, notably for its deep-water port which is one of the few in the region. The city's name, pronounced "Wy-nee'mee", has a Chumash origin, meaning "Resting Place". Established in 1948, Port Hueneme has a diverse community and offers recreational opportunities with scenic beaches, a maritime museum, and annual events like the Hueneme Beach Festival. Its coastal climate attracts tourists and serves as an ideal habitat for the unique flora and fauna of the region.

energy

Port Hueneme, California, has taken strides in improving energy efficiency and sustainability. As part of California's broader initiative to reduce carbon emissions and increase the use of renewable energy sources, Port Hueneme has encouraged the adoption of solar panels on both residential and commercial properties. The city's mild climate is conducive to solar energy production, reducing dependence on fossil fuels. The Port of Hueneme, a cornerstone of the local economy, has also implemented initiatives to reduce energy consumption, such as upgrading to LED lighting and investing in electric equipment and vehicles. Furthermore, energy efficiency programs and rebates for homeowners and businesses, offered through local utilities and government incentives, have promoted energy-saving upgrades and practices. The city has established building codes to ensure new construction adheres to high energy efficiency standards, which include proper insulation, energy-efficient windows, and the installation of Energy Star appliances. Moreover, Port Hueneme actively participates in statewide energy-saving programs that aim to decrease overall energy usage during peak hours, contributing to a more stable and efficient energy grid.

water

Water conservation and efficiency are vital in Port Hueneme, as California faces periodic droughts. The city has prioritized sustainable water use by supporting xeriscaping with drought-tolerant plants, reducing the need for frequent watering. Landscape irrigation systems throughout the city are increasingly being upgraded to include smart controllers that use weather data to minimize water wastage. Port Hueneme residents are encouraged to fix leaks promptly, and the city provides resources to help detect and repair water leaks in homes and businesses. Rebate programs are in place for water-efficient appliances, such as high-efficiency toilets and washing machines. The city also invests in stormwater management infrastructure to capture and reuse rainwater, lessening the demand on the municipal water supply. Additionally, the city has educational outreach programs to inform the public about the importance of water conservation. The Port of Hueneme is committed to reducing water usage in its operations and has implemented water-saving measures such as using seawater for cooling and cleaning as part of their environmental initiatives.

transportation

Transportation in Port Hueneme is integral to the quality of life and economic vitality of the city. As part of its commitment to sustainability, the city has been working to improve transportation efficiency by enhancing public transit options and infrastructure. The city supports the use of alternative transportation modes such as biking and walking by maintaining and expanding bike lanes and pedestrian paths. Public transportation is facilitated by regional bus services, providing connections to nearby cities and reducing the number of vehicles on the road. The Port of Hueneme is known for being the first port on the West Coast to adopt a shoreside power system, which allows docked ships to plug into the local power grid and shut down diesel engines, significantly reducing emissions. Additionally, the port has implemented a clean air plan that includes the use of cleaner-burning fuels and the deployment of electric vehicles within its operations. The city offers incentives for electric vehicle ownership, including rebates and the installation of charging stations to promote the transition from fossil-fuel-powered vehicles. To further enhance transportation efficiency, local planning ensures that future developments are accessible and conducive to sustainable transit options.

waste

Waste management in Port Hueneme is a critical component of the city's environmental stewardship. The city has a robust recycling program, which helps to divert waste from landfills and promotes the reuse of materials. Curbside recycling services are widely available, accepting a variety of materials including plastics, paper, glass, and metals. To further combat waste, the city has encouraged composting and offers resources for residents to compost at home, turning organic waste into valuable soil amendments. Electronic waste is collected through special events and drop-off centers, preventing hazardous substances from contaminating the environment. Port Hueneme businesses are also involved, with many adopting practices to reduce, reuse, and recycle materials within their operations. The city has implemented an ordinance for single-use plastic bag reduction, which has led to a decrease in plastic waste and litter. Additionally, Port Hueneme is exploring waste-to-energy technologies that could potentially convert waste into a source of renewable energy, thus reducing the overall environmental impact of waste disposal.
